Shops and Goods
  • About
  • Articles
  • Advice to buyers
  • Home
  • Massachusetts
  • Braintree
  • Visionworks - South Shore Plaza

Visionworks - South Shore Plaza

Information Photos Comments
Visionworks - South Shore Plaza, 250 Granite St, Braintree, MA 02184, USA,


Related: goodwill chanhassen
Related: braintree mall pet store
Related: target optical richmond
Category: Eye Care Center
Address: 250 Granite St, Braintree, MA 02184, USA
Phone: +1 781-843-0586
Site: visionworks.com
Rating: 1
Working: 10AM–9PM 10AM–9PM 10AM–9PM 10AM–9PM 10AM–9PM 10AM–9PM 11AM–6PM

Location




Photos 11

Reviews 3

SA

Sasi Venugopal

I had my vision test and got new pair of glasses all good so far. Then a couple of weeks ago my frame broke and one of the lenses popped out. Later unable to find that lens i went to get a new lens for that eye. They are pretty efficient, and i got the lens set in an hour. NOW... when i try them on... CRAP i cannot see anything properly. They said may be because my glasses were not aligned before, and now that it is you will feel better in a day. "Okay".... so i tried it over the weekend.. and got a bad .. real bad headache... To my relief I found the lens I had lost before, and replaced the "sick" lens myself.... and the world looked better now. GUESS WHAT THE ERROR WAS..... THEIR SYSTEM HAD INCORRECT LENS NUMBER. I am yet o discover what the issue was.... but i guess instead of a "PLUS", they gave me a "MINUS" ...WAS A CRAPPY WEEKEND , and the rating is for spoiling it.


PA

Paul L

Rude staff. One of the male employees who I can only assume was the manager was yelling at a female employee that she was taking too long with me. I felt like I was just a dollar sign not a customer that was cared about.


AU

Audrey Rynne

terrible, just dont go here, they messed everythng up I have now been waiting six weeks for my glasses UNACCECPTIBLE !!!!



35 most recent searches


the pawn shop modesto american parkway dealer allentown pa abc supply houston nissan dealer in la quinta california pikes peak harley davidson colorado springs colorado ed martin honda service edgewater ace hardware pearle vision taylor mi prime toyota lancaster delano chevrolet dealership advance auto parts snohomish ethan allen bellevue wa petco washtenaw officemax hallandale beach anthropologie breton village tattoo shops in broken arrow biltmore house gift shop workbench true value colon auto sales tractor supply co inver grove heights mn bevmo visalia hours fastsigns 96th street unt union bookstore sears outlet store fenton mo earth treasures estate jewelry purple haze lexington ky trucksmart auburn silver bullet rockaway albertsons barrows kroger hebron ohio cherian indian grocery store total wine northridge kroger grosse ile grand home furnishings charlottesville carquest winchester

Other organizations

EY Eye See Quality Eye ...
LE LensCrafters
IN Independent Eye Care
VI Visionworks - Endico...
LE LensCrafters
LE LensCrafters
AD Advanced Eye Center ...
AD Advanced Eye Centers...
IN Independent Eye Care...
MA Market Square Optica...
EY Eyephoria Optical
PA Parrelli Optical

Photos

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A
Eye Care Center «Visionworks - South Shore Plaza», reviews and photos, 250 Granite St, Braintree, MA 02184, USA

Photos of comments

  • Back to top
  • Home
  • About
  • Advice to buyers

© Shops and Goods 2015-2026